NET环境下基于UGjournal的异型辊设计模块二次开发_第1页
NET环境下基于UGjournal的异型辊设计模块二次开发_第2页
NET环境下基于UGjournal的异型辊设计模块二次开发_第3页
NET环境下基于UGjournal的异型辊设计模块二次开发_第4页
NET环境下基于UGjournal的异型辊设计模块二次开发_第5页
已阅读5页,还剩1页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

.NET环境下基于UGjournal的异型辊设计模块二次开发作为一款受欢迎的CAD软件,UG软件具有非常广泛的应用领域,尤其在制造领域中使用非常广泛。在制造过程中,机械设备通常需要涉及到辊道等结构,因此针对辊道的设计和制造是一项十分重要的任务。本文将重点介绍基于.NET环境下UGJournal的异型辊设计模块二次开发的相关内容。

一、UGJournal简介

UGJournal是UGNX软件内置的一种程序语言,它类似于常见的脚本语言,可以利用它实现UG软件的自动化程序。UGJournal可以帮助用户快速实现UG软件中的各种设计、分析和制造操作,同时也具有较高的可重复性和可维护性。

二、异型辊设计模块的基本功能

异型辊设计模块是一款基于UGJournal的二次开发模块,其主要功能是为UGNX软件提供一个可以方便地设计异型辊的工具。模块主要包含以下主要功能:

1.用户定义辊的几何形状,支持多种形状类型。

2.快速生成和编辑辊的轮廓曲线和截面图形。

3.支持在辊的两端添加轮轴,用户可以选择轮轴的直径和位置。

4.支持多个辊组成的辊道的设计,支持辊与辊之间的距离、角度和其他参数的调整。

5.提供多种导出文件格式,支持将设计结果输出为CAD文件、PDF文件等格式。

三、二次开发模块的实现思路

异型辊设计模块的实现思路主要分为以下几个步骤:

1.分析用户需求,确定模块的需求和功能。例如:定位异型辊的基本形状、辊与轮轴的连接方式、支持多个辊组合成辊道等。

2.设计模块的用户界面,根据需求设计界面的交互流程和控件布局。

3.编写UGJournal脚本程序,通过程序实现设计和计算的自动化。

4.编写UI层和脚本程序之间的中间层,实现UI层与脚本程序之间的数据交互和功能调用,扩展程序的灵活性和可扩展性。

5.对模块进行测试和优化,确保程序的稳定性和可靠性。

四、重点考虑的问题

1.对不同形状的辊的支持:由于用户可能需要设计多种形状的异型辊,因此需要考虑对不同形状的辊的支持。可以通过提供多种形状选择、自定义辊形状等方式来实现。

2.对程序的性能要求:在使用UGJournal脚本程序实现设计和计算自动化的同时,需要兼顾程序的性能。可以通过使用高效的算法和优化代码实现程序的高效执行。

3.对界面交互的优化:对界面的设计和操作方式的交互优化是关键。可以通过使用简洁清晰的界面布局和直观的操作方式提高用户的使用体验。

五、总结

通过以上分析和讨论,我们可以得出基于.NET环境下UGJournal的异型辊设计模块二次开发的相关内容。本模块可以帮助用户快速实现异型辊的设计,提高设计效率和质量。同时,它的开发过程也需要综合考虑程序性能、用户交互、不同形状的辊的支持等因素,以确保模块的稳定性、可扩展性和易用性。为了进行分析,我们需要获得二次开发模块的相关数据。以下是一些可能需要收集并分析的数据:

1.模块的使用情况:收集模块的安装量、访问量、使用频率等数据,以了解模块的使用情况和受欢迎程度。

2.设计任务的类型分布:收集用户使用模块进行设计的任务类型,如辊道、输送设备等,以了解模块在不同应用领域中的应用情况。

3.设计参数的分布:收集用户在使用设计模块时输入的设计参数,如轮轴直径、辊道长度等,以了解这些参数的分布规律和一般取值范围。

4.模块的稳定性、处理速度:收集模块在不同场景下的表现数据,如反应速度、处理能力等,以了解模块的稳定性和性能表现。

5.用户满意度:通过用户反馈、调查问卷等方式收集用户对模块的评价和反馈,以了解用户满意度和需求状况。

通过对以上数据的收集和分析,我们可以得到以下几点结论:

1.模块的使用情况较好,受欢迎程度较高。

2.设计任务的类型分布广泛,应用领域非常广泛。

3.设计参数的分布规律和一般取值范围比较明确,可以为模块的设计参数提供参考或默认值。

4.模块的稳定性和性能表现较好,用户在使用过程中的反馈也比较正面。

5.用户满意度高,但仍存在一些用户需求和反馈,如界面优化、功能扩展等。

基于以上结论,我们可以对模块进行进一步的优化和改进,以满足用户的需求并提高模块的可用性和易用性。同时,我们也可以根据数据分析结果,为用户提供更好的使用体验和更多的工具支持,提高用户的满意度和忠诚度。以某企业使用的二次开发模块进行分析,该模块是一款基于AutoCAD平台的轮轴设计软件,主要用于轮轴的渐进轮缘轮廓及背滚程的计算与绘制。

该企业收集了大量关于该二次开发模块的使用数据并进行了分析。通过对数据的挖掘和分析,他们得出了以下结论:

1.模块的使用情况好,受欢迎程度较高,每个月平均有350名用户在使用该模块进行设计。

2.设计任务的类型分布广泛,应用领域包括机械制造、船舶制造、航空制造等领域。

3.设计参数的分布规律较为明确,包括轮轴外径、进给、角度等参数均有一般取值范围,可为设计提供参考值。

4.模块的稳定性和性能表现良好,同时处理速度较快,符合用户的期望。

5.用户满意度较高,大多数用户对该模块给予正面评价,但仍有一些用户反馈了一些希望改进的方面,例如界面优化、用户手册完善等。

基于这些结论,该企业根据用户反馈进行了模块的优化和改进,包括增加部分新功能、优化模块界面、完善用户手册等,以提高模块的易用性和用户满意度。

通过数据分析,在现代企业中二次开发模块已经成为了工业设计领域中十分广泛且重要的工具。同时,数据分析也使得企业可以从用户的使用和反馈

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论